MiroFish-Offline Roadmap

Current State (v0.2.0)

Fully local fork running on Neo4j CE + Ollama. All Zep Cloud dependencies removed. Core pipeline works: upload text → build knowledge graph → entity extraction → simulation → report generation.


Near Term

v0.3.0 — Stability & Python Compatibility

  • Fix camel-oasis / camel-ai compatibility with Python 3.12+ (currently requires <3.12)
  • Add Docker Compose GPU auto-detection (fallback to CPU-only Ollama)
  • Connection resilience: auto-reconnect to Neo4j on transient failures
  • Add /api/status endpoint showing Neo4j connection state, Ollama model availability, and disk usage
  • Structured logging with JSON output option

v0.4.0 — Search & Retrieval Improvements

  • Tune hybrid search weights (currently 0.7 vector / 0.3 BM25) — make configurable per graph
  • Add graph-aware reranking: boost results connected to the query entity
  • Support multiple embedding models (e.g., mxbai-embed-large, bge-m3 for multilingual)
  • Implement edge-weight decay for temporal relevance in simulations

Hardware Tiers

Tier RAM GPU VRAM Recommended Model Expected Performance
Minimal 8 GB — (CPU only) qwen2.5:3b Slow, basic NER quality
Light 16 GB 6-8 GB qwen2.5:7b Usable for small graphs
Standard 32 GB 12-16 GB qwen2.5:14b Good for most use cases
Power 64 GB 24+ GB qwen2.5:32b Full quality, fast
